Presence in the Strait
Scarce summer visitor found in areas of reedbeds. Wintering birds have been seen over recent years. Extincs as a breedeeer when La Janda dried out but started again at the beginning of the ´90s at the River Guadiaro estuary and La Janda.
Identification
The smallest heron, with highly contrasting plumage. In flight, large buff-white wing-patches. Juvenileshave cryptic plumage, similar to the Eurasian Bittern.
Movements
Migrant with peaks in the 2nd hf. of April and August.
